]> gitweb.fluxo.info Git - puppet-nodo.git/commitdiff
Adding ensure parameter to domain::check
authorSilvio Rhatto <rhatto@riseup.net>
Fri, 25 Nov 2011 15:27:08 +0000 (13:27 -0200)
committerSilvio Rhatto <rhatto@riseup.net>
Fri, 25 Nov 2011 15:27:08 +0000 (13:27 -0200)
manifests/subsystems/domain.pp

index b4d09549e7d34d32fd9b2884275394a61a7c6d21..d076052c77417b24b4486192e9c63b8bb72b33a8 100644 (file)
@@ -11,9 +11,9 @@ class domain {
     source  => "puppet://$server/modules/nodo/bin/domain-check",
   }
 
-  define check($interval = '60', $email = 'root', $hour = '0',
-               $minute   = '0',  $weekday = '0',
-               $file = false) {
+  define check($interval = '60',  $email   = 'root', $hour = '0',
+               $minute   = '0',   $weekday = '0',
+               $file     = false, $ensure  = present) {
 
     $cert_check = "/usr/local/bin/domain-check -a -q -x ${interval} -e ${email}"
 
@@ -28,7 +28,7 @@ class domain {
       hour     => $hour,
       minute   => $minute,
       weekday  => $weekday,
-      ensure   => present,
+      ensure   => $ensure,
       require  => File["/usr/local/bin/domain-check"],
     }
   }